Vermicompost is literally worm poo, usually known as worm casts or worm castings. If you’ve at any time noticed minimal spirals of clustered, worm-shaped soil to the area of your garden, or around beds and borders, it’s because worms are extremely good at churning the soil.

It is a reasonably easy course of action that consists of including water to a little amount of vermicompost. Go away for every week or so to brew so that the nutrients seep to the drinking water making the liquid fertilizer.

In a standard compost pile or bin, microbes, microorganisms and humidity break down kitchen area and garden scraps into a light natural materials. This type of compost needs heat, generated via the germs, and time to cool down and overcome, which may take 6 months or even ev boosters more.

There are several explanation why vermicomposting has started to become a lot more common than standard composting techniques. First of all, this method allows in cutting down odors that compost piles can emit while simultaneously becoming a comparatively passive technique of creation.
